    What Is a Tax Credit?


    Subtract tax credits from the amount of tax you owe. There are two types of tax credits:
    • A nonrefundable tax credit means you get a refund only up to the amount you owe.
    • A refundable tax credit means you get a refund, even if it's more than what you owe.

    What Is a Tax Deduction?

    Subtract tax deductions from your income before you figure the amount of tax you owe.
